Lockdown day 4
Rock’s mission to extricate our Manchild from Uni was highly successful. No roadblocks had been set up, no official papers were necessary and the nun disguise was, in these lean times, a waste of precious resources.
Manchild came bearing ridiculously thoughtful gift in the shape of a 4 pack of solid gold; Aloe Vera scented toilet rolls.
Manchild states that as a university student of computing he has been self isolating and living off rations for 2.5 years – this is except when he and his fellow nerds are in pub …which are all now shut… thus lockdown for Manchild is a walk in the park…as long as you are not:
in a group of no more than 2
closer than 2m from other park walkers
suffering from a new persistent cough and fever
are not exceeding ones “once a day” outdoor allowance

Went on mission of mercy for lovely neighbour. Packed snacks, charged phone and sharpened elbows ready for the new supermarket experience (updated March 25th 2020) … but alas, sharp elbows were surplus to requirements. Supermarket has implemented new, sensible 300 person maximum plus a handy 1 in/1 out rule so shopping was positively relaxing.
Decided I like shopping during a pandemic…providing it is organised properly.
